Overview

An undulating walk around the back of Hascombe village over the B2130, uphill and then heading north turning back towards Juniper Valley and Busbridge Woods before climbing again to Hydon's Ball.  We return partly on the Greensand Way and then over The Hurtmore to the carpark via a steep downhill section.  There are some lovely views but the ground is likely to be very muddy for part of our journey.  Boots and sticks advised.  There is a pub opposite the carpark

Starting point

Grid reference:
TQ 00147 39436
Nearest postcode:
GU8 4JB
what3words:
chapels.hologram.outgrown
Start time:
10:15 am

The carpark is located to the south of the B2130 just after a sharp right hand bend if travelling from Godalming with the White Horse pub opposite
